It is with a heavy heart that the Lauderhill Fire Department announces the passing of one of its own, Firefighter Wayne Ware.

Wayne is a twenty-five year member of the Lauderhill Fire Department. Before his passing, he was assigned to the Fire Prevention Bureau where he was a senior Fire Inspector and Plans Examiner. Wayne was an Air Force veteran and an avid amateur radio operator.

Last Friday morning, surrounded by his family and friends, he lost his long and courageous battle with cancer. He is survived by his wife and two young daughters.
